Background:
- Neuronal Cell Adhesion Molecule (NRCAM) is crucial for neural development and circuitry organization.
- Human genetic studies link NRCAM to autism susceptibility.
- Autism Spectrum Disorders (ASD) are characterized by social deficits, repetitive behaviors, and cognitive rigidity.
Purpose of the Study:
- To investigate the role of NRCAM in social behavior, learning, and sensorimotor gating using Nrcam-null mice.
- To model autism-related behavioral phenotypes, including social deficits and cognitive rigidity.
- To assess sex-dependent effects of Nrcam deficiency on behavior.
Main Methods:
- Evaluation of Nrcam-null mice and wild-type controls in behavioral assays.
- Assays included sociability (three-chambered choice task), social novelty preference, and reversal learning.
- Control measures included anxiety tests (elevated plus maze, open field), motor coordination, and olfactory tests.
Main Results:
- Nrcam-null mice exhibited sex-dependent behavioral alterations.
- Male Nrcam-null mice showed significantly decreased sociability, without changes in anxiety or motor coordination.
- Both male and female Nrcam-null mice displayed reversal learning deficits; female mice also showed impaired spatial learning acquisition.
Conclusions:
- Loss of NRCAM function leads to behavioral changes relevant to autism spectrum disorder symptoms.
- NRCAM plays a role in mediating sociability, spatial learning, and cognitive flexibility.
- These findings highlight NRCAM as a significant genetic factor in neurodevelopmental disorders like autism.
